Saying Bahala Na can mean that you are able to surrender to something that is greater than you, something so beautiful that encompasses the Universe and beyond.
To surrender is to acknowledge that we are part of something larger than that which we can control. To surrender is to admit our powerlessness and to open ourselves to God’s light and love.
—Holly W. Whitcomb, Seven Spiritual Gifts of Waiting: Patience, Loss of Control, Living in the Present, Compassion, Gratitude, Humility, Trust in God